Honda's E-Compressor: A Game-Changer for the Motorcycle Industry?

Honda's recent developments in engine technology have sparked excitement among motorcycle enthusiasts. The company's focus on the V3R engine and its innovative E-Compressor has the potential to revolutionize the industry. While the V3R engine configuration is intriguing, it's the E-Compressor that truly captivates my interest. This technology, if successfully implemented, could be a game-changer for motorcycle performance.

The E-Compressor is an electronically controlled compressor that uses electricity to spin, providing near-instant boost compared to the lag from a conventional turbocharger. Honda claims that this technology gives its 900cc prototype a level of performance on par with a 1,200cc motorcycle. What makes this particularly fascinating is the potential for widespread adoption. The E-Compressor is not limited to the V3R engine configuration; it could be applied to any engine type, from inline-fours to parallel-twins and flat-sixes.

Honda has filed several patents for the E-Compressor, addressing the challenge of packaging the compressor and motor in between existing engine components. This is not the first time Honda has attempted to adopt new technologies across its engine lineup. The company has previously explored DCT and e-Clutch systems, indicating a pattern of innovation and adaptability.

However, it's important to note that patents don't always lead to production motorcycles. Cost efficiency, profitability, and real-world performance are critical factors that can influence the success of new technologies.
